Transaction 74c8180907657f0e81d54282048910935908b330e49ffb4bb0b7a32ae1281863

1 Input
2 Outputs
  • 74c8180907657f0e81d54282048910935908b330e49ffb4bb0b7a32ae1281863:0
  • value  5000000
    address  3DV48WxykPh6CUagjC1U8vAmfzHSUY64Um
  • 74c8180907657f0e81d54282048910935908b330e49ffb4bb0b7a32ae1281863:1
  • value  45274019
    address  33ZQn7CJ48rXaizDAsJx7qAZfsJQ6taBD7